El objetivo de este artículo es revisar los conceptos respecto al ameloblastoma que se han publicado recientemente y valorar su influencia en la actitud del clínico a la hora de actuar frente a esta patología, tomando como punto de partida para ilustrar está discusión la presentación de nuestra experiencia respecto al ameloblastoma.Ameloblastoma is a benign odontogenic tumour of epithelial origin without induction in the connective tissue. In treating this type of tumour, it is important to assess the clinical type (solid, multicystic, unicystic, peripheral), localisation, and size of the tumour as well as age of the patient. Articles have recently been published with the purpose of providing updated knowledge and therapeutic approaches to ameloblastoma. We present six cases of patients with localised mandibular ameloblastoma who were treated during the last seven years. We present data on clinical appearance, histological characteristics, and therapeutic approach that was used, which included excision of the lesion, perilesional drilling of the bone, or block resection, according to the type of ameloblastoma. Lastly, we analysed follow-up measures and the rate of recurrence in these patients. The aim of this paper is to review the concepts relating to ameloblastoma that have been published recently and to assess their influence on the clinical attitude taken when facing this pathology, using our experience with ameloblastoma as a starting point to illustrate this discussion

    Quality of life (QL) in oral cancer patients has become one of the most important parameters to consider in the diagnosis and post-treatment follow-up. The purpose of this article has been to review the papers published that study the QL in oral cancer patients, the different QL questionnaires used, the clinical results obtained, and the systematic revisions available in the indexed literature for the last 10 years. The term QL appears as a keyword in an increasing number of articles throughout the past 10 years; however, few studies focus on oral cancer. Most of them assess all head and neck cancers, which conform to a heterogeneous group with several different features depending on location (oral cavity, oropharynx, larynx, hypopharynx, nasopharynx and salivary glands). Most studies evaluate QL in short periods of time, normally within the first year after the diagnosis. Series do not discern between different therapeutic options, and they generally center on Northern European or Northern American populations. There are few instruments translated and validated into Spanish that measure QL, a fundamental characteristic to link QL to own patients? socio-cultural parameters. Data related with QL are mostly related to patient (age, sex, co-morbidity), tumour (location, size), and treatment (surgical treatment, radiotherapy association, reconstruction, cervical dissection, and/or feeding tube). Nowadays QL?s assessment is considered an essential component of an oral cancer patient as well as the survival, morbidity and years free of disease. Although many aspects related to QL in oral cancer patients have been published throughout the past 10 years, more systematic research is needed to be able to apply it on a daily basis

    Purpose and Introduction: Dentigerous cysts are epithelial in origin and are the most commonly found cyst in children. The majority of these lesions are usually a radiological finding and are capable of quite large before being diagnosed. The standard treatment for these cysts is the enucleation and the extraction of the affected tooth. However, if the patient is a child and the affected tooth is not developed, a more conservative attitude should be considered. Material and Methods: (Clinical case): A 7-year-old patient is presented with an eruptive backlog of the lower permanent first molars. Radiological examination reveals two radiolucid lesions in relation to them, which are compatible with a dentigerous cyst, and in relation to the inferior aveolar nerve and various germs. A partial enucleation is carried out, maintaining all the dental germs related to the cyst in mouth and monitoring the patient until the case study is over. Results and Discussion: Diagnosis and early treatment of these lesions in children is of great importance, especially in cases where the lesions enclose permanent teeth. Conclusions: Whenever possible, a conservative attitude should be taken, one that allows for the maintenance of the dentition and treatment of the associated cyst in order to not compromise either the occlusion or the mental state of these patients

    Objective: The effects of insulin or insulin resistance on the lipid profile seem to change with age. The aim of this study was to analyze insulin levels and an insulin resistance index and to investigate the relationship between these and the lipid profile in a population-based sample of Spanish prepubertal children. Methods: 1048 (524 boys and 524 girls) randomly selected prepubertal children were studied. Children were 6 to 8 years old with a mean age of 6.7. Plasma lipid, FFA and insulin levels were measured. The homeostatic model assessment (HOMA) was calculated as an indicator of insulin resistance. Results: When analyzing percentile values of insulin, HOMA and FFA by sex, we observed that girls had significantly higher insulin concentrations than boys (except at the 10th percentile) and significantly higher FFA (except at the 90th percentile) with no significant differences between sexes for HOMA. Multivariate regression analyses showed that insulin was positively associated with glucose, triglycerides and apoB in boys but not in girls, and negatively associated with FFA in both genders. Conclusions: We report here data about the distribution of insulin in the Spanish prepubertal population. The higher levels of insulin in prepubertal girls could indicate that girls start to be more insulin resistant than boys at this age, although other manifestations of insulin resistance are not yet detectable.pre-print211 K

    Recently, 94 inborn errors of immunity (IEI) patients suffering from COVID-19 have been described, overall demonstrating a mild phenotype [1] although more severe disease manifestations have been suggested for patients with alterations in the interferon (IFN) signaling pathway, including auto-antibodies against type I IFN [2]. Patients with STAT1 GOF mutations show a complex and often severe phenotype, combining an increased susceptibility of fungal, (myco-) bacterial and viral infections as well as autoimmune and autoinflammatory manifestations [3]. Characteristically, in response to type I and type II IFN stimulation, these patients show STAT1 hyperphosphorylation [3, 4]. Whether in the context of SARS-CoV-2 infection, the hyperactivation of the IFN-JAK1/2-STAT1 pathway would be protective (antiviral effect) or deleterious (hyperinflammation) is unclear.     Background: We aimed to describe the epidemiology, risk factors, and clinical outcomes of co-infections and superinfections in onco-hematological patients with COVID-19. Methods: International, multicentre cohort study of cancer patients with COVID-19. All patients were included in the analysis of co-infections at diagnosis, while only patients admitted at least 48 h were included in the analysis of superinfections. Results: 684 patients were included (384 with solid tumors and 300 with hematological malignancies). Co-infections and superinfections were documented in 7.8% (54/684) and 19.1% (113/590) of patients, respectively. Lower respiratory tract infections were the most frequent infectious complications, most often caused by Streptococcus pneumoniae and Pseudomonas aeruginosa. Only seven patients developed opportunistic infections. Compared to patients without infectious complications, those with infections had worse outcomes, with high rates of acute respiratory distress syndrome, intensive care unit (ICU) admission, and case-fatality rates. Neutropenia, ICU admission and high levels of C-reactive protein (CRP) were independent risk factors for infections. Conclusions: Infectious complications in cancer patients with COVID-19 were lower than expected, affecting mainly neutropenic patients with high levels of CRP and/or ICU admission. The rate of opportunistic infections was unexpectedly low. The use of empiric antimicrobials in cancer patients with COVID-19 needs to be optimized

    The relationship between different types of innovation is analysed from three different approaches. On the one hand, the distinctive view assumes that the determinants of each type of innovation are different and therefore there is no relationship between them. On the other hand, the integrative view considers that the different types of innovation are complementary. Finally, the product–process matrix framework suggests that the relationship between product innovation and process innovation is substitutive. Using data from Spain belonging to the Technological Innovation Panel (PITEC) for the years 2008, 2009, 2010, 2011 and 2012, we tested which of the three approaches is predominant. To perform the hypothesis test, we used the so-called complementarity approach. We find that there is no unique relation. The nature of the relationship depends on the types of innovation that interact. Our most significant finding is that the relationship between product innovation and process innovation is complementary. This finding contradicts the proposal of the product–process matrix framework. Consequently, the joint implementation of both types of innovation generates a greater impact on the performance of a company than the sum of their separate implementation

    Severe Acute Respiratory Syndrome Coronavirus (SARS-CoV)-2 infection induces an exacerbated inflammation driven by innate immunity components. Dendritic cells (DCs) play a key role in the defense against viral infections, for instance plasmacytoid DCs (pDCs), have the capacity to produce vast amounts of interferon-alpha (IFN-α). In COVID-19 there is a deficit in DC numbers and IFN-α production, which has been associated with disease severity. In this work, we described that in addition to the DC deficiency, several DC activation and homing markers were altered in acute COVID-19 patients, which were associated with multiple inflammatory markers. Remarkably, previously hospitalized and nonhospitalized patients remained with decreased numbers of CD1c+ myeloid DCs and pDCs seven months after SARS-CoV-2 infection. Moreover, the expression of DC markers such as CD86 and CD4 were only restored in previously nonhospitalized patients, while no restoration of integrin β7 and indoleamine 2,3-dyoxigenase (IDO) levels were observed. These findings contribute to a better understanding of the immunological sequelae of COVID-19

    The aim was to assess the ability of nasopharyngeal SARS-CoV-2 viral load at first patient’s hospital evaluation to predict unfavorable outcomes. We conducted a prospective cohort study including 321 adult patients with confirmed COVID-19 through RT-PCR in nasopharyngeal swabs. Quantitative Synthetic SARS-CoV-2 RNA cycle threshold values were used to calculate the viral load in log10 copies/mL. Disease severity at the end of follow up was categorized into mild, moderate, and severe. Primary endpoint was a composite of intensive care unit (ICU) admission and/or death (n = 85, 26.4%). Univariable and multivariable logistic regression analyses were performed. Nasopharyngeal SARS-CoV-2 viral load over the second quartile (≥ 7.35 log10 copies/mL, p = 0.003) and second tertile (≥ 8.27 log10 copies/mL, p = 0.01) were associated to unfavorable outcome in the unadjusted logistic regression analysis. However, in the final multivariable analysis, viral load was not independently associated with an unfavorable outcome. Five predictors were independently associated with increased odds of ICU admission and/or death: age ≥ 70 years, SpO2, neutrophils > 7.5 × 103/µL, lactate dehydrogenase ≥ 300 U/L, and C-reactive protein ≥ 100 mg/L. In summary, nasopharyngeal SARS-CoV-2 viral load on admission is generally high in patients with COVID-19, regardless of illness severity, but it cannot be used as an independent predictor of unfavorable clinical outcome

    Solid organ transplant (SOT) recipients are especially at risk of developing infections by multidrug resistant (MDR) Gram-negative bacilli (GNB), as they are frequently exposed to antibiotics and the healthcare setting, and are regulary subject to invasive procedures. Nevertheless, no recommendations concerning prevention and treatment are available.
